What is World Vegan Day?

World Vegan Day, celebrated annually on November 1, is a day dedicated to raising awareness about the benefits of veganism for both individuals and the planet. Established in 1994 by the Vegan Society, this day aims to promote the vegan lifestyle, encouraging people to explore plant-based diets and reflect on the ethical, environmental, and health implications of their food choices.

The History of World Vegan Day

The inception of World Vegan Day can be traced back to the Vegan Society’s 50th anniversary, where it was decided that a day would be designated to celebrate veganism and its positive impact. The day has since grown in popularity, with events and activities organized globally that highlight the advantages of a vegan lifestyle.

Why is World Vegan Day Significant?

This day holds great significance as it not only promotes a healthier lifestyle but also addresses pressing issues like animal rights and environmental sustainability. By embracing veganism, individuals can reduce their carbon footprint, conserve water, and save countless animals from suffering. It’s a day that empowers people to make informed choices about their diets and encourages discussions around the future of food.

How is World Vegan Day Observed?

Celebrations vary worldwide, ranging from community events, potlucks, and workshops to social media campaigns. Many restaurants and cafes offer special vegan menus, while organizations host educational sessions about the benefits of veganism. People are encouraged to share their vegan meals online, using hashtags like #WorldVeganDay to spread awareness.

Fun Facts About Veganism

  • The term “vegan” was first coined in 1944 by Donald Watson, co-founder of the Vegan Society.
  • More than 1.5 million Americans identify as vegan, a number that has significantly increased over the past decade.
  • Plant-based diets have been linked to lower risks of heart disease, type 2 diabetes, and certain cancers.
  • World Vegan Day is celebrated in various countries, including the UK, USA, Australia, and India, showcasing its global impact.
